Abstract

The utility model discloses a kind of open high speed and exchanges board, is related to computer card technical field;The utility model provides a kind of open high speed and exchanges board, deployment general controls agreement openflow on the CPU management for exchanging board, include sRIO and Ethernet, sRIO uses RapidIO exchange chips, Ethernet uses Broadcom exchange chips, it is described to exchange the backboard specification BKP6 CEN16 11.2.2 n that board uses openVPX, Ethernet topological structure is Dual Star, sRIO topological structure is Dual Star+Daisy Chain, and is interconnected by sRIO buses and Ethernet buses with complete machine;Exchange board of the present utility model meets openVPX standards, improves the hardware compatibility between board, to the openflow interfaces for concentrating network controller to provide standard, convenient centralized management and unified allocation of resources resource, realizes the efficient utilization of Internet resources.

Background technology
The demand handled with high-performance data and the development of cloud computing, traditional exchange board are difficult to meet high-performance number According to the requirement exchanged with open expansible architecture for exchanging.The utility model provides a kind of open high speed and exchanges board, meets OpenVPX standards, improve the hardware compatibility between board, convenient centralized management and unified allocation of resources resource, realize network The efficient utilization of resource.
Open Architecture framework OpenVPX is system-level standard, and it is simultaneous to define system on VPX normative foundations Hold framework.
Switch control agreement OpenFlow, OpenFlow interchanger is managed by remote controllers.OpenFlow Interchanger include one or more flow tables and one group of table, perform packet lookup and forwarding, and to peripheral control unit OpenFlow Channel.The interchanger is communicated with controller, and manages interchanger by OpenFlow protocol controller.

Embodiment
The utility model provides a kind of open high speed and exchanges board:
General controls agreement openflow is disposed on the CPU management for exchanging board, comprising sRIO and Ethernet, SRIO uses RapidIO exchange chips, and Ethernet uses Broadcom exchange chips, and the exchange board is used OpenVPX backboard specification BKP6-CEN16-11.2.2-n, Ethernet topological structure is Dual Star, sRIO topological structure It is Dual Star+Daisy Chain, and is interconnected by sRIO buses and Ethernet buses with complete machine.
The utility model is further illustrated by embodiment and with reference to accompanying drawing:
CPU management uses MPC8548 Management Processor in the utility model, disposes general controls agreement Openflow, the completely open function of exchanging board, unified communications protocol is provided for Centralized Controller, exchange system is mainly wrapped Containing sRIO and Ethernet, sRIO is exchanged using special RapidIO exchange chip IDT CPS-1848, and Ethernet is used Broadcom StrataXGS series exchange chips, exchange the backboard specification BKP6-CEN16- that board meets openVPX 11.2.2-n, the Ethernet topological structure of the backboard Normalization rule is Dual Star, and sRIO topological structure is Dual Star + Daisy Chain, the backboard specification defines a machine system of 16 grooves, wherein 2 grooves are to exchange groove, remaining 14 are Load groove;Power board card is interconnected by sRIO buses and Ethenet buses with complete machine, and the whole board that exchanges is easier to from hardware Extension.Exchange and communicated between board and system Centralized Controller using openflow agreements, exchange all resources of board, Speed, route assignment including port, the control of node data flow, communication data statistics, exchange the function such as data filtering can be with Controlled by Centralized Controller.Centralized Controller provides application layer general programming API, allows user by being programmed to Efficiently manage, utilize the purpose of Internet resources.
